summaryrefslogtreecommitdiffstats
path: root/src/multimedia/audio/qaudiosystem.cpp
diff options
context:
space:
mode:
authorLars Knoll <lars.knoll@qt.io>2020-12-16 16:00:41 +0100
committerLars Knoll <lars.knoll@qt.io>2021-01-20 15:28:26 +0000
commit58e74015c5239f269a1f0a59eabe43e92c47acd5 (patch)
tree0324430d8d0e4cabdcab2b86095637dbd06d9ba5 /src/multimedia/audio/qaudiosystem.cpp
parent57888ffdaf4ebf0538954aa47f101ce0af1887de (diff)
Move Windows audio code over into Qt Multimedia
Change-Id: Ib4f652b49a2d0805a5a44e9f2114b24ab366cdb5 Reviewed-by: Doris Verria <doris.verria@qt.io> Reviewed-by: Lars Knoll <lars.knoll@qt.io>
Diffstat (limited to 'src/multimedia/audio/qaudiosystem.cpp')
-rw-r--r--src/multimedia/audio/qaudiosystem.cpp4
1 files changed, 4 insertions, 0 deletions
diff --git a/src/multimedia/audio/qaudiosystem.cpp b/src/multimedia/audio/qaudiosystem.cpp
index 5408297d0..289a08b04 100644
--- a/src/multimedia/audio/qaudiosystem.cpp
+++ b/src/multimedia/audio/qaudiosystem.cpp
@@ -46,6 +46,8 @@
#include <private/qalsainterface_p.h>
#elif defined(Q_OS_DARWIN)
#include <private/qcoreaudiointerface_p.h>
+#elif defined(Q_OS_WIN)
+#include <private/qwindowsaudiointerface_p.h>
#endif
QT_BEGIN_NAMESPACE
@@ -429,6 +431,8 @@ QAudioSystemInterface *QAudioSystemInterface::instance()
system = new QAlsaInterface();
#elif defined(Q_OS_DARWIN)
system = new QCoreAudioInterface();
+#elif defined(Q_OS_WIN)
+ system = new QWindowsAudioInterface();
#endif
}
return system;